    Understanding the Conversion

    The key to converting between meters and inches lies in understanding the base units. Meters are part of the metric system, while inches belong to the imperial system. To successfully convert, we need a conversion factor:

    • 1 meter = 39.37 inches (approximately)

    This means that for every meter, there are approximately 39.37 inches. This conversion factor is the cornerstone of our calculation.

    Calculating Inches in 3 Meters

    Now that we know the conversion factor, let's calculate how many inches are in 3 meters:

    1. Multiply the number of meters by the conversion factor: 3 meters * 39.37 inches/meter = 118.11 inches

    Therefore, there are approximately 118.11 inches in 3 meters.

    Rounding and Precision

    In practical applications, you might round the answer to a more manageable number. For example, you could round 118.11 inches to 118 inches. The level of precision needed depends on the context. For rough estimations, rounding is acceptable. For precise work, however, it's better to retain more decimal places.
